JAVAPKICA数字化企业信任模型.doc

上传人:自*** 文档编号:126205994 上传时间:2020-03-23 格式:DOC 页数:4 大小:42.95KB
返回 下载 相关 举报
JAVAPKICA数字化企业信任模型.doc_第1页
第1页 / 共4页
JAVAPKICA数字化企业信任模型.doc_第2页
第2页 / 共4页
JAVAPKICA数字化企业信任模型.doc_第3页
第3页 / 共4页
JAVAPKICA数字化企业信任模型.doc_第4页
第4页 / 共4页
亲,该文档总共4页,全部预览完了,如果喜欢就下载吧!
资源描述

《JAVAPKICA数字化企业信任模型.doc》由会员分享,可在线阅读,更多相关《JAVAPKICA数字化企业信任模型.doc(4页珍藏版)》请在金锄头文库上搜索。

1、JAVA论文:数字化企业PKI/CA认证系统的设计【中文摘要】公钥基础设施PKI(Public Key Infrastructure)是一个用公钥概念和技术来实施和提供安全服务的具有普适性的安全基础设施。它是开展电子商务、电子政务、网上银行等网络服务的不可缺少的安全基础设施。其研究对互联网的发展有着重要的促进作用。以Java为核心技术的J2EE平台足SUN公司倡导的现代分布对象技术的国际标准,在该领域已占据主导地位。基于JAVA平台构建PKI/CA系统,是目前较为流行的技术规划和建设数字化企业PKI/CA认证体系,需要根据企业的时机情况,统一进行认证体系机构的设计。CA的体系结构多种多样,现如

2、今企业除总部外,还设有级公司,由总部对二级公司垂直管理。为了解决企业二级公司访问内部网络的身份认证的问题,解决企业并购其他企业后,原属不同信任域的用户间要经常通信的问题,结合对认证系统的认识以及当前国际上比较先进和成熟的设计思路,本课题设计方案采用两层结构体系:即根CA和二级CA,使系统具备良好的扩张基础:本课题着眼于PKI/CA的现行国际标准的研究,并在此基础上提出了基于.JAVA平台的PKI/CA的面向对象设计方案。这种设计方案有利于提高系统的稳定性、安全性和跨平台能力.【英文摘要】PKI (Public Key Infrastructure) is a universal securit

3、y infrastructure which is implement and providing security services with public-key concepts and techniques. It is the development security infrastructure for carrying out electronic commerce. electronie government. online banking. The research has an important promoted role on the development of th

4、e internet.J2EE platform which centers on Java is internationa standards core technology by SUN modern distributed object technology. which dominates in this .【关键词】JAVA PKI CA 数字化企业 信任模型【英文关键词】JAVA PKl CA digital office trust model【索购全文】联系Q1:138113721 Q2:139938848【目录】数字化企业PKI/CA认证系统的设计摘要4-5ABSTRACT5

5、第1章 绪论9-111.1 课题研究背景9-101.2 国内外现状分析101.3 论文的主要研究内容与思路10-11第2章 JAVA及其相关技术11-162.1 基于J2EE的应用程序模型11-132.2 JSP系统环境概述13-142.3 面向对象方法14-152.4 本章小结15-16第3章 公钥基础设施PKI16-293.1 概述163.2 PKI的主要组成与功能16-193.2.1 注册机构RA17-183.2.2 认证机构CA18-193.2.3 资料库193.3 PKI相关标准19-213.3.1 实现PKI的标准19-203.3.2 X.500203.3.3 LDAP20-213

6、.3.4 LDAP认证方法213.4 PKI的应用标准213.5 安全套接字层(SSL)21-243.5.1 安全套接字21-223.5.2 握手协议22-243.5.3 数据传输243.5.4 通信协议标准243.6 数字证书24-273.6.1 证书简介24-273.6.2 X.509规范273.7 服务器安全分析和异步线程的同步性27-283.7.1 服务器安全27-283.7.2 异步线程的同步性283.8 本章小结28-29第4章 系统实现框架29-634.1 信任模型设计294.2 系统模块图29-364.2.1 系统总体层次模块图29-314.2.2 CARA通信功能模块图314

7、.2.3 CA服务器多线程图解31-334.2.4 CA数字证书申请流程33-344.2.5 系统管理模块图34-354.2.6 RA设计35-364.3 UML顺序图36-414.3.1 数字证书的申请顺序图36-374.3.2 数字证书的发布顺序图37-384.3.3 系统启动顺序图38-394.3.4 管理员登陆并进入管理员配置页面的顺序图39-404.3.5 用户注册顺序图404.3.6 用户审核顺序图40-414.4 UML类图41-434.4.1 生成数字证书的类图414.4.2 CA与RA通信中完成基于SSL/TLS通信的类图41-424.4.3 CA与RA通信的类图42-434

8、.5 数据库设计43-464.6 类的实现46-484.6.1 实体类46-474.6.2 操作类47-484.6.3 连接类484.7 系统实现48-594.7.1 通信中RACA的实现方法48-514.7.2 证书的制作51-554.7.3 LDAP服务器55-564.7.4 系统管理的实现56-594.8 系统开发关键技术59-604.8.1 通信过程中传输信息的序列化594.8.2 系统多线程技术594.8.3 解决根证书密钥的存取问题594.8.4 解决系统异步线程的同步问题59-604.8.5 口令加密604.8.6 图形验证码604.9 系统测试60-624.9.1 CA服务器测试60-614.9.2 用户管理系统测试61-624.10 本章小结62-63第5章 结论63-64参考文献64-67致谢67-68个人简历68

展开阅读全文
相关资源
相关搜索

当前位置:首页 > IT计算机/网络 > 其它相关文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号